Bali's Relationship to Nature

  • Bali furniture is so popular because it creates a strong connection to nature. By incorporating natural materials like teak, rattan, and bamboo, Balinese furniture seamlessly merges interior spaces with the surrounding tropical environment. This biophilic design, aesthetic allows for a harmonious transition between indoors and outdoors, reflecting the essence of Balinese culture and lifestyle. The use of natural elements not only enhances the beauty and authenticity of the furniture but also brings a sense of tranquility and serenity into living spaces. 

Calming and Tranquil 

  • Balinese furniture is rooted in a design philosophy that emphasizes balance, harmony, and a deep connection to nature, fostering a calming and tranquil atmosphere—ideal for creating peaceful resort environments.

Durability

  • Balinese furniture, especially pieces crafted from teak and other high-quality hardwoods, is renowned for its exceptional durability and natural grain beauty. These materials resist moisture, pests, and wear, allowing the furniture to endure various weather conditions with minimal maintenance. This makes them ideal for both indoor and outdoor resort settings, where longevity and resilience are essential.

Authentic

  • Balinese furniture adds an element of cultural authenticity and exotic charm to resorts, providing guests with a unique and immersive experience. Guests are drawn to the mystical and serene ambiance that Balinese furniture creates, transporting them to a different world filled with beauty and tradition

Quality Control in Balinese Furniture Manufacturing

  • The quality control process for Balinese furniture is both meticulous and ongoing, ensuring each piece upholds the highest standards from start to finish. Skilled artisans and dedicated supervisors are involved at every stage, closely monitoring both the craftsmanship and the materials being used.
  • Open communication between design teams, factory artisans, and clients helps guarantee the finished furniture meets specific expectations—down to the smallest detail.
  • Before packaging and shipping, every single product undergoes a thorough inspection. Artisans carefully check for structural integrity, finish consistency, and any imperfections, making sure that each item is as beautiful and resilient as promised.
  • This hands-on approach not only preserves the authenticity of Balinese design but also ensures that every piece arriving at its destination—whether it's a five-star resort or a luxury villa—is of exceptional quality and ready to impress.

Bali’s Relationship With Biophilic Design and Materials

Bali's Relationship With Biophilic Design and Materials

Bali's strong connection with nature makes it an ideal setting for embracing biophilic design principles and materials. By incorporating elements such as abundant natural light, local plants, and sustainable materials like bamboo and rattan, Balinese architecture effortlessly blurs the lines between indoor and outdoor spaces. This approach not only enhances the aesthetic appeal of buildings but also promotes well-being by creating a serene and harmonious environment. The use of traditional techniques and materials in construction further highlights Bali's commitment to sustainable living and ensures that the island remains a haven for those seeking a deeper connection with nature. In essence, Bali serves as a living example of how biophilic design can positively impact both individuals and the environment.
